CAUTION: You can copy and paste between application sessions and between
sessions and the desktop, however, this function depends on session server
configurations.
TIP: In addition to the standard two-button mouse, the thin client supports a Microsoft
Wheel Mouse (used for scrolling). Other similar types of a wheel mouse may or may
not work.
To switch the left and right buttons, use the Peripherals dialog box (see "Peripherals").
